CICD DevOps Engineer
Job Summary
We are seeking a CI/CD DevOps Engineer (Automotive / Embedded Software) to support the development and optimisation of automated software delivery pipelines across embedded and automotive environments.
You will work within a cross-functional engineering team to improve build systems streamline testing workflows and ensure consistent high-quality deployments across multiple environments.
This position suits an engineer with strong automation experience solid DevOps tooling knowledge and exposure to embedded or automotive software systems.

Key Responsibilities:
- Maintain and enhance automated CI/CD pipelines supporting automotive and embedded software delivery.
- Configure and manage build and deployment workflows using tools such as Jenkins GitLab CI or GitHub Actions.
- Implement containerised build environments using Docker to ensure reproducible and scalable builds.
- Integrate automated testing frameworks static analysis tools and validation checks into CI pipelines.
- Develop deployment automation across development staging and production environments including rollback mechanisms.
- Provide internal DevOps tooling and scripting support to engineering teams to improve development efficiency.
- Monitor pipeline performance ensuring reliability stability and fast feedback loops for developers.
- Work closely with version control systems (Git-based workflows) to support continuous integration practices.
- Create and maintain technical documentation covering CI/CD architecture workflows and operational processes.
- Set up alerting and notification systems for build failures test results and deployment issues.
Qualifications :
Required Skills:
- Strong hands-on experience with CI/CD platforms such as Jenkins GitLab CI or GitHub Actions
- Solid understanding of Git and modern version control workflows
- Experience developing automation scripts using Python Java or Bash
- Proven experience with build automation and pipeline orchestration
- Practical knowledge of Docker and container-based development environments
- Background in CI/CD processes including automated testing builds and deployments
- Experience working in automotive or embedded systems environments (essential requirement)
Required Qualifications:
- A Bachelors or Masters degree in Engineering or equivalent military experience.
Desirable Skills:
- Familiarity with automotive software standards such as AUTOSAR or similar embedded frameworks.
- Exposure to embedded Linux or real-time software systems.
- Experience with infrastructure-as-code tools such as Terraform or Ansible.
- Understanding of build systems like CMake Maven or Gradle.
- Experience working in fast-paced engineering environments with distributed teams.
